What Makes A Kitchen Sink Problem An Emergency
Not every sink issue requires immediate service, but active leaks, overflowing water, severe backups, and complete drainage failures often do. Fast action can prevent a manageable repair from becoming a larger restoration project.
- Water actively leaking from plumbing
- Sink overflowing during use
- Drainage completely blocked
- Water collecting inside cabinets
- Recurring backups becoming worse
Common Causes Of Kitchen Sink Emergencies
Many urgent sink failures develop from wear, blockages, damaged fittings, or plumbing defects hidden beneath the sink. Identifying the source is essential before repairs begin.
- Grease and debris accumulation
- Damaged drain assemblies
- Loose plumbing connections
- Cracked pipes or fittings
- Failed sink components
The Risks Of Waiting Too Long
Delaying repair often allows water to spread into surrounding materials and can increase cleanup requirements. Even small leaks can create larger problems when left unresolved.
- Cabinet damage
- Flooring deterioration
- Water spreading into nearby areas
- Persistent drainage issues
- Higher repair costs later

When Complete Replacement May Be Needed
Some emergencies reveal extensive wear or damage that cannot be reliably repaired. In those situations, replacement may provide the safest long-term solution.
- Severely damaged components
- Repeated repair failures
- Cracked plumbing assemblies
- Extensive corrosion
- Unsafe plumbing conditions
